Notes
*This recipe works best with thinner chicken breasts. If they are too thick, cut them in half and/or pound them into thinner pieces. This will help them crisp up and cook through properly.**Feel free to use more garlic for a more intense flavor.Tips:
Don't skip patting the chicken dry. This helps the seasoning to better adhere.
Take care not to burn the garlic; this will lead to a bitter sauce.
If you'd like a more buttery sauce, you can add an additional 2 tablespoons of butter.
